LEXINGTON, Va. – The 32nd-ranked Washington and Lee men's tennis team posted an 8-1 victory over Bridgewater College on Thursday afternoon at the Duchossois Tennis Center.
The Eagles (1-5, 0-4) provided little resistance to the Generals in doubles, as the Blue & White swept the three points without dropping a game.
In singles play, Bridgewater claimed a win at the No. 1 position, but W&L took the remaining five matches in straight sets. Sophomore
Evan Brady (Glen Head, N.Y./Chaminade) surrendered just one game in posting a 6-0, 6-1 victory over Matthew Gordon at the No. 2 position. First-years
Connor Coleman (Birmingham, Ala. / Briarwood Christian) and
Christian Basnight (Virginia Beach, Va. / Landstown) both dropped just three total games in their straight-set victories. Coleman felled Nick Kiser at No. 3 singles by a score of 6-1, 6-2 and Basnight won 6-3, 6-0 over Bryce Cline at No. 6 singles.
The win improved W&L to 34-0 all-time against the Eagles and moved the Generals to 4-1 overall this spring. The Blue & White also carries a 4-0 mark in conference play.
Washington and Lee continues a busy week on Saturday when it hosts Hampden-Sydney for a 2:00 pm match.
